Take a previously illegal substance, one that has been vilified for decades; make it legal to produce, sell, and consume in some locations and not others; consider the substance to be illegal federally and apply tax treatments as if the substance were still illegal; and you create a level of complexity that can confuse even expert accountants

Cannabis and CBD Accountants Have Their Work Cut Out for Them

It’s true that the legality of marijuana and hemp-based products is constantly changing in our country, and this means any business that wants to profit from these emerging—and mostly unregulated—markets, needs accounting assistance of the highest quality.

Cannabis Companies Are at a Disadvantage

Perhaps a stigma is associated with selling something that was previously illegal, but the fact remains cannabis businesses will find it almost impossible to get off the ground without professional expertise to back them up. Many vendors will not service cannabis companies, and this includes banks, merchant services, point of sale vendors, lawyers, and accounting firms.

Many states require cannabis companies to use “seed to sale” tracking systems, which are difficult to use and don’t integrate well with accounting software. They must follow strict accounting guidelines for monthly, quarterly, and annual reporting. Finally, since the industry is brand new, there aren’t many resources for accounting tools, industry guides, or generally accepted accounting principles (GAAP) businesses can follow on their own.
